2.1 General Overview of Property Records Jersey City
Property records are official documents that provide essential information regarding properties and land ownership. In Jersey City, these records can vary from ownership history and tax assessments to any liens or encumbrances associated with the property.
Key Components of Property Records
-
Property Ownership: This indicates who legally owns the property. It includes names, transaction dates, and the type of ownership (individual, joint tenancy, etc.).
-
Property Description: A detailed description of the property, including its boundaries, area, and sometimes a visual representation or survey.
-
Zoning Information: This shows the current zoning classification of the property, which is vital for understanding how the land can be used (residential, commercial, industrial, etc.).
-
Tax Assessments: Information about current and past tax assessments, which can give insight into the financial obligations tied to the property.
-
Transfer History: A chronological account of property sale transactions, helping to trace the history and value changes of a property over time.

Misconception 3: All Property Records Are Publicly Accessible
While many property records are public, not all types of information are freely available. For example, sensitive information like financial details may not be accessible without proper authorization. It’s essential to understand what specific details you can retrieve and what may require special permission.

2.6 Challenges or Limitations of Property Records Jersey City
While property records are valuable tools, challenges do exist that users must be aware of.
Common Challenges
-
Information Overload: With the breadth of information available, novice users may feel overwhelmed.
-
Errors in Records: Occasionally, inaccuracies can occur in records. It’s essential to verify all information through multiple sources.
-
Access Restrictions: Not all information may be publicly accessible, leading to frustration when seeking sensitive records.
